WHEREAS,weight restrictions are in effect during the spring thaw season. Streets may be posted for weight restrictions any time that road and weather conditions warrant weight limits to protect streets from damage. WHEREAS, impacted streets will be signposted. The city follows MnDOT scheduling from imposing and removing spring road weight limit restrictions Dates are posted at http://dotapp7.dot.state.mn.us/research/seasonal load limits/sllindex.asp or by calling (651) 366- 5400 or toll free at 1-800-723-6543. These dates generally fall between March.1st and May 15th dependent on weather conditions. WHEREAS, exceptions to the seasonal load limits in Orono are made for emergency response vehicles, school buses and emergency utility repair vehicles/equipment: WHEREAS, an exemption is provided for refuse collection vehicles to exceed the posted limits, except no refuse collections vehicles shall be operated during restricted times where the gross weight on any single axle exceeds seven(7)tons. WHEREAS, an exemption is allowed for utility companies providing utility service within the City when responding to an emergency. An emergency response shall include power outages, gas leaks, emergency communication, line down or severed, etc. WHEREAS, an exemption to posted weight limits is also allowed for septic tank service companies, well drilling and service companies, and companies delivering fuel for heating purposes. An emergency response is limited to septic or sewer system failures posing an imminent threat to public health and safety, well failure resulting in loss of water supply, or lack of heating fuel. WHEREAS, all persons requesting an exemption to the posted weight limits for response to an emergency situation must notify the Orono Police Department Administrative office. This notification must include a description and location of the emergency, the number and weight of vehicles responding to the emergency, and the route to be used to reach the emergency site. The City reserves the right to request supporting documentation of the nature and location of the emergency.
